The Fundamentals of Engineering (FE) Exam is a standardized test required for engineers in the United States who want to become Professional Engineers (PEs). It's typically taken by recent engineering graduates or students nearing the end of their engineering degree program. The exam covers foundational engineering concepts across multiple disciplines including civil, mechanical, electrical, and chemical engineering, and passing it is the first step toward PE licensure.

The FE Exam tests broad engineering knowledge across many disciplines, requiring students to master both theoretical concepts and practical problem-solving under time pressure. Many students struggle with the breadth of material—you can't just focus on your specialty—and the exam's emphasis on quick recall and efficient problem-solving. Additionally, balancing FE preparation with coursework or early career responsibilities can make dedicated study time difficult to find.

The FE Exam covers a wide range of engineering fundamentals organized into major categories: mathematics, probability and statistics, ethics and professional practice, engineering sciences (including mechanics, thermodynamics, and materials), and discipline-specific modules like civil, mechanical, electrical, or chemical engineering. The exam also includes questions on computers and software, and professional and social context. Most students benefit from 8-12 weeks of consistent preparation, though this varies based on your engineering background and how much time you can dedicate each week. If you're recently out of school or still in your engineering program, you may need less time; if there's been a gap, you might benefit from longer preparation. Practice problems are essential—they're how you build both conceptual understanding and test-taking speed. The FE Exam is heavily problem-based, so working through hundreds of practice questions helps you recognize problem types, apply formulas correctly, and develop the time management skills you'll need on test day.
